Product Description

Includes PSP Go!Cam camera

See your home like you've never seen it before - full of creatures that are only visible through a PSP Go!Cam camera. Invizimals invites you on a weird and wonderful hunt for the virtual creatures that the camera will pick up as you move around - locate them with the game's built-in sensor, creep up on them - and trap as many as possible!

  • Use the PSP Go!Cam camera to hunt down invisible animals and capture them
  • Pit your Invizimals against each other or enjoy multiplayer fights with friends
  • Learn new attacks, power up, and evolve your Invizimals
  • Trade Invizimals and magical items with your friends or online

4 out of 5 stars Remarkable, but a note of caution   July 31, 2010
nemo (UK)
This game is remarkable. The augmented reality is rock solid - moving the camera around the animals doesn't produce any lag, they really look like they are there. The combat is simple enough but not simplistic. In all, a really interesting PSP game.

My note of caution concerns the camera. If you are a cheapskate like me, you'll have held off getting the stand-alone PSP-300 camera (the silver one), as this package - Invizimals with camera - seems a much better deal. Sadly, it isn't.

This pack does not include the same camera. Invizimals comes with the black PSP-450 camera. The difference isn't just cosmetic - the PSP-300 is better. The PSP can use either camera without any additional software, straight from the XMB. Both cameras can shoot video up to 480x272@30fps.

The problem comes when shooting stills - the silver PSP-300 camera is 1.3 megapixels, or up to 1280x960 pixels. The black PSP-450 that comes with Invizimals can only do 0.3 megapixels or 640x480 - one quarter of the PSP-300! Now 1.3 megapixels is hardly impressive these days, but it's a decent enough toy camera. The PSP-450 however is next to useless for stills.

In conclusion, if you're interested in using the PSP to take still photographs, do not get Invizimals with an included camera - get the PSP-300 Sony Go! Cam (PSP) separately, and the stand-alone Invizimals Invizimals (PSP).

3 out of 5 stars Not fantastic!!!   May 15, 2010
kerry (UK)
0 out of 1 found this review helpful

I saw the adverts and thought this game would be fantastic to the point that i was excited about having a go myself, i couldn't wait for my step son to open the present that we had bought but when i had to go through it to show him how to play it, i was very dissapointed - i think that i had far too many high expectations for this game as i found the tutorials at the beginning were far too long winded and bored me very quickly and i was unable to skip them.

The graphics are good and the idea behind it is good and i found running around the house fun but sometimes the colours that they want you to find (especially yellow) were difficult to find and even when i found something yellow the camera found it hard to detect even though i was looking directly at it. I thought the game would be a lot more fun judging by the adverts. The fighting at first was ok but got a bit tedious after a few fights and would probably be better with a bit more free play or something to keep the kiddies a lot more entertained for longer. Can't see this entertaining my step-son for long.

Hope this is useful for other peeps wanting to buy this - personally glad i didn't pay more than £10.00 for it as would have been dissapointed but all in all i wouldn't recommend buying it at all.
